技术文摘
什么是 MySQL 主机名
什么是 MySQL 主机名
在数据库领域,MySQL 是广泛使用的关系型数据库管理系统。当涉及到连接 MySQL 数据库时,MySQL 主机名是一个重要的概念。那么,什么是 MySQL 主机名呢?
简单来说,MySQL 主机名是用于标识运行 MySQL 数据库服务器的计算机的名称。它在网络环境中起到定位和访问数据库服务器的关键作用。无论是在本地开发环境,还是在企业的生产环境中,正确理解和使用 MySQL 主机名对于成功连接和操作数据库至关重要。
在本地开发时,MySQL 主机名常常会使用“localhost”或“127.0.0.1”。“localhost”是一个特殊的主机名,它指向本地计算机自身,代表数据库服务器就运行在当前使用的这台电脑上。“127.0.0.1”则是对应的 IPv4 环回地址,同样表示本地机器。这种情况下,开发人员可以方便地在自己的电脑上进行数据库的开发与测试工作,无需复杂的网络配置。
然而,在更为复杂的网络环境中,比如企业的服务器集群或云服务环境里,MySQL 主机名可能会是一个域名或者服务器的实际 IP 地址。如果数据库服务器部署在企业内部网络的特定服务器上,那么主机名可能就是该服务器在企业网络中的标识名称。而在使用云数据库服务时,云提供商通常会分配一个特定的主机名,这个主机名用于用户从外部网络访问其托管的 MySQL 数据库。
准确地知道 MySQL 主机名是建立数据库连接的第一步。当使用数据库客户端工具,如 MySQL Workbench,或者在编写代码连接数据库时,都需要提供正确的主机名信息。错误的主机名会导致连接失败,使得数据库无法正常访问和操作。
MySQL 主机名是连接和访问 MySQL 数据库服务器的关键标识。理解它的含义、在不同环境下的表现形式,对于数据库管理员、开发人员以及任何需要与 MySQL 数据库交互的人来说,都是至关重要的基础知识。
- 大数据实战:Flink 与 ODPS 历史累计计算项目的分析及优化
- 21 个 Python 工具——开发者必备
- 你掌握前后台分离开发了吗?
- Python GUI 编程:dearpygui 与 tkinter 的对比及选择
- Elasticsearch 聚合查询学习之旅
- Python sympy 库快速入门:轻松攻克数学难题
- Python 文件操作:高效处理文件之法
- IntelliJ IDEA 助力高效的 Java 代码分析与性能调优
- Pandas 中数据选择与过滤的终极指引
- Python 数据存储效率提升的神器:shelve 与 dbm 的优势及应用!
- matplotlib 中多子图布局的实现方法
- 用户注册的安全玩法
- 8000 字与 25 图深入解析 Xxl-Job 核心架构原理
- Typescript 相较 Javascript 的优点有哪些?
- 2024 年 API 的六大发展趋势